Vegetarian Seafood Delight

About this recipe

Indulge in a vibrant and mouthwatering blend of plant-based ingredients that mimic the taste and texture of seafood. This 'Vegetarian Seafood Delight' brings the ocean to your table without any actual fish, using vegetarian shrimp, hearts of palm, and artichokes. Perfect for a health-conscious meal, this dish is both delicious and satisfying.

Ingredients

  • 1 package (8 oz) of vegetarian shrimp
  • 1 can (14 oz) of hearts of palm, drained and rinsed
  • 1 can (14 oz) of artichoke hearts, drained and rinsed
  • 1 red bell pepper, sliced
  • 1 yellow onion, sliced
  • 2 cloves of garlic, minced
  • 1 tablespoon of ol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on of paprika
  • 1 teaspoon of dried thyme
  • 1/2 teaspoon of sal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on of black pepper
  • 1/4 cup of vegetable broth
  • 1/4 cup of white wine
  • 1/4 cup of fresh parsley, chopped

Directions

  1. 1

    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).

  2. 2

    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at.

  3. 3

    Sauté red bell pepper and onion slices for 5 minutes until soft.

  4. 4

    Add minced garlic, paprika, thyme, salt, and black pepper; cook for 1 minute.

  5. 5

    Stir in vegetarian shrimp, hearts of palm, artichoke hearts, vegetable broth, and white wine.

  6. 6

    Transfer mixture to a baking dish and bake for 20 minutes.

  7. 7

    Sprinkle fresh parsley over the top before serving.

Chef's tip

Feel free to substitute vegetarian shrimp with tofu or mushrooms for a different texture. Adjust spices to your preference for extra flavor.
